Mavericks planning to sign former All-Star Kemba Walker

The Dallas Mavericks are in the process of signing former All-Star guard Kemba Walker in hopes of improving their playmaking talent around Luka Dončić, per Marc Stein.

The Mavericks will waive Argentine guard Facundo Campazzo, whose deal was non-guaranteed, to open up a roster spot for Walker.

A four-time All-Star, Walker started 37 games with New York last season, averaging 11.6 ppg and 3.5 apg on .537 TS% before both parties came to a mutual agreement that Walker would sit out the remainder of the season after he fell out of the rotation.

On draft night, was traded to Detroit along with the draft rights to Jalen Duren, where he was waived.

He has spent the season training in Florida.

At his peak, Walker was an elite scorer and a capable passer who toiled on some subpar Charlotte teams before linking up with Boston ahead of the 2019-20 season.

A durable guard earlier in his career, the 32-year-old has struggled through knee issues in recent years and has suffered a noticeable decline in burst and quickness.

Last season in New York, Walker shot the three-ball at a steady clip despite many of his looks being heavily-contested or off the bounce and was a useful passer and playmaker but struggled as an isolation scorer and had a difficult time finishing at the rim.

He is a hard-working defender but has had difficulties being a difference-maker on that end due to his small frame.

The departure of Jalen Brunson, who averaged 21.6 ppg and 3.7 apg across 18 playoff games last season, has left a major hole in Dallas’ rotation just a season on from their first Western Conference Finals appearance since 2011.

Dallas are currently on a four-game losing streak and have dropped to 9-10 on the year.

Dončić has put up MVP-calibre numbers – 33.1 ppg, 8.7 rpg and 8.4 apg – but the team has struggled to generate offence outside of him; their offence is still above league-average, however, their heliocentric approach is looking unsustainable long-term.

The Mavericks will host the Warriors tomorrow before a quick, two-game road trip to face the Pistons and the Knicks.
